Transaction 581ddf71bb5e1bef094a9c3d8e6cac7bc07b2eaa605cee43983bbd9a90fbfc20

2 Input
2 Outputs
  • 581ddf71bb5e1bef094a9c3d8e6cac7bc07b2eaa605cee43983bbd9a90fbfc20:0
  • value  3328952
    address  16UvsCbPgQkrxbk8Jx9XTd5CSH7dtRLZXn
  • 581ddf71bb5e1bef094a9c3d8e6cac7bc07b2eaa605cee43983bbd9a90fbfc20:1
  • value  13289753
    address  3BiupcYneDxb4FUbkJbTfe4i2Wi5vdJNQb